About Us

# A family-led program built on lived experience.

ElizaBeth and Mishka Wildemaan bring decades of teaching, caregiving, and study together to create a program that respects every individual.

> "A place to feel whole and be seen for who you are and what you can be."

Founder 

## ElizaBeth Wildemaan

![ElizaBeth Wildemaan](/__l5e/assets-v1/ff1e1d63-3663-4030-ae20-c73b5a4e0edc/dirt.jpg)

ElizaBeth began working with adults with intellectual and developmental disabilities in 1987. She has worked with I/DD adults for over a decade and has raised a son with autism. Through her educational background, she has studied child and human development for over 30 years.

Knowledge of child development is also of great value when working with adults, many adults still struggle with unmet childhood developmental challenges. If these unmet stages can be identified, remedial work can help ameliorate the challenges.

### Background

-   BS, Elementary Education, University of Missouri-Columbia
-   Certificate in Waldorf Education, Antioch New England
-   MA Organizational Psychology, University of the Rockies
-   14 years teaching general education, grades 1-8
-   3 years of school administration
-   10+ years of direct care of I/DD adults
-   23 years of being a mom to an autistic young man
-   Decades studying Waldorf & Jungian human development

Operations & Care 

## Mishka Wildemaan

Mishka has gained valuable experience working with and caring for his brother, Corbin Wildemaan. He understands that meeting needs on an individual basis is the best approach for positive change. His education supports the business's needs of record-keeping, website development, client relations, and more.

### Background

-   General studies at Yavapai Community College
-   Web Development & CS at Front Range Community College
-   Decades of caring for a sibling with autism

A day program for adults with I/DD

State-authorized SCC provider for adults with I/DD, funded primarily through the Medicaid DD Waiver, with additional Mill Levy SCC as a Mill Levy provider for RMHS. Currently contracted with Rocky Mountain Human Services (RMHS) and Developmental Pathways, with capacity for additional CMA partnerships. We also offer Non-Medical Transport and residential services.
